Adam Goucher has been testing professionally for over 12 years at a range of organizations from national banks to startups. A large part of that time has been spent augmenting his exploratory testing with automation.
After discovering Selenium during a capital budget freeze in 2006, it quickly became his tool of choice when automating web interfaces. As an active member of both the core development team and the larger Selenium community he has recently started to revitalize the IDE project in an effort to kickstart business adoption of it.
Automation is not the only tool in his toolbox. As an experienced tester who believes in the principles of both the Context School of Testing and the Agile Manifesto he brings an open and modern view of testing to projects.
His first book, Beautiful Testing was published in October 2009.

Open Source Selenium Frameworks
- Saunter is designed to get you up and running with Selenium-based automation within as short a time as possible. We maintain two different implementations:
- Py.Saunter in Python
- SaunterPHP in PHP
- ChemistryKit is a new Ruby project from Arrgyle which implements the ideas encapsulated in Saunter.
